Police Officer Salary in Rockford, Illinois

The median police officer salary in Rockford, IL is $53,948 per year, which is 18% below the national median and 13.7% below the Illinois state average.

Police Officer Salary in Rockford by Experience

In Rockford, an entry-level police officer earns around $34,440, while experienced professionals earn up to $80,360 per year. The local cost of living index is 82% of the national average.

Salary Percentiles in Rockford, IL

Percentile Rockford
10th Percentile $33,128
25th Percentile $41,984
Median (50th) $53,948
75th Percentile $71,504
90th Percentile $86,920
